Imagine being able to use the brushes once wielded by a master like Edvard Munch. From the vaults of the Oslo Munch museum they have now been digitally recreated for you to use. How might they inspire your own creativity?

Edvard Munch's "The Scream of Nature" invites it's viewers to a moment of drama and imagination. The painting pictures a figure on a walkway screaming towards the viewer with a dreamlike landscape in the background. To me, this scene has always been rather exciting, inviting and mysterious. Why the scream? Whats with the setting? Who are the figures in the back?

For my contribution to this contest I have decided to focus on the identity of the main character. To bring my questions regarding the painting to the surface. To me, a scream like the one Edvard Munch painted, is a battle. A struggle within oneself. To isolate that scream and enhance the imagined feeling of the character, whilst all other props outside in reality becomes irrelevant. How we express our thoughts and how our inner conversations are narrated are important tools for us.
During this whole process I've only used two brushes (Filbert & Short Flat Blender) and the gradient tool. I've worked in Photoshop CC 2017 and have used my trusted 
Wacom Intous pro tablet. I've taken great practical inspiration from "The Scream of Nature" in form of palette.
